What is the addendum for coastal area property
The addendum for coastal area property is a legal document that modifies or adds specific terms to an existing real estate contract, particularly for properties located in coastal regions. This addendum addresses unique considerations such as environmental regulations, flood zones, and coastal development guidelines that are essential for both buyers and sellers. It ensures that all parties are aware of the potential risks and obligations associated with coastal properties, which may be subject to stricter zoning laws and environmental protections.
Key elements of the addendum for coastal area property
Several key elements are typically included in the addendum for coastal area property. These may encompass:
- Disclosure of Risks: Information regarding potential hazards such as flooding, erosion, and hurricanes.
- Regulatory Compliance: Requirements to adhere to local, state, and federal regulations concerning coastal properties.
- Insurance Requirements: Specifications for necessary insurance coverage, including flood insurance.
- Development Restrictions: Limitations on construction and modifications to protect the coastal environment.
These elements help ensure that all parties involved understand the implications of purchasing or selling coastal property.
How to use the addendum for coastal area property
Using the addendum for coastal area property involves several steps. First, it should be attached to the main real estate contract. Both parties must review the addendum carefully to understand its implications. Next, the sellers should provide any necessary disclosures regarding the property’s coastal status and any risks involved. Finally, both parties must sign the addendum to make it legally binding. This process ensures that all parties are informed and agree to the specific terms related to the coastal property.

Legal use of the addendum for coastal area property
The legal use of the addendum for coastal area property is crucial for protecting the interests of all parties involved in a real estate transaction. This document must comply with state and federal laws governing real estate transactions and coastal property regulations. It serves as a formal acknowledgment of the unique risks associated with coastal properties, which can help mitigate potential legal disputes in the future. Properly executed, the addendum becomes part of the binding contract, reinforcing its legal standing.
State-specific rules for the addendum for coastal area property
State-specific rules regarding the addendum for coastal area property can vary significantly. Each state may have unique regulations concerning coastal development, environmental protections, and disclosure requirements. It is essential for parties involved in the transaction to consult local real estate laws to ensure compliance. This may include understanding specific coastal zone management regulations or any additional disclosures mandated by state law. Consulting with a real estate attorney familiar with local laws can provide valuable guidance.
